R4H17A provides these features:

Incredible Efficiency with Wi-Fi 6

  • The Aruba 570 Series Outdoor Access Points support the Wi-Fi 6 standard, including features such as orthogonal frequency-division multiple access (OFDMA), bi-directional Multi-User MIMO (MU-MIMO), and Target Wait Time (TWT).
  • Patented RF optimization technologies like ClientMatch have also been enhanced with Wi-Fi 6 awareness to group Wi-Fi 6-capable client devices together for optimized network utilization.
  • The Aruba 570 Series also supports Air Slice, a unique capability that enhances OFDMA with SLA-grade application assurance from the access point to the client device

Infrastructure Designed with Flexibility in Mind

  • The Aruba 570 Series Outdoor Access Points are purpose-built to deliver unified connectivity and support flexible deployment options.
  • This product can be managed by Aruba Central, as well as with existing on-premises and local management options.
  • It is purpose-built to survive in the harshest outdoor environments, withstanding exposure to extreme high and low temperatures, persistent moisture, and is sealed to keep out airbourne contaminants.

IoT Platform Capabilities

  • The Aruba 570 Series Outdoor Access Points have the ability to support up to 512 associated clients per Wi-Fi radio – ideal for organizations deploying Wi-Fi connected IoT devices.
  • Supports Bluetooth 5 and Zigbee® wireless protocols through an integrated IoT radio, and third-party expansion with an integrated USB port.
  • Features improved client visibility with integrated device profiling, and the option for advanced insights when integrated with ClearPass Policy Manager or ClearPass Device Insight.

Specification

R4H17A Specification

 

R4H17A Specification

Ports 

(1) HPE SmartRate RJ-45 port, auto-sensing link speed (100/1000/2500BASE-T) and MDI/MDX. 2.5 Gbps speed complies with NBASE-T and 802.3bz specifications (1) 10/100/1000BASE-T (RJ-45) port, auto-sensing link speed and MDI/MDX 

Mounting 

Not included. Choose AP-270-MNT-V1, AP-270-MNT-V2, AP-270-MNT-H1, AP-270-MNT-H2 

Input voltage 

IEEE 802.3at PoE, or direct DC power (via optional power supply) 

Power Consumption 

25.6W, max (AP only) 

Certifications 

CB Scheme Safety, cTUVus UL2043 plenum rating Wi-Fi Alliance certified 802.11a/b/g/n/ Wi-Fi CERTIFIED 6 (802.11ax) Wi-Fi CERTIFIED ac (with Wave 2 features) Passpoint® (Release 2) with ArubaOS and Instant 

Regulatory 

FCC/ISED CE Marked RED Directive 2014/53/EU EMC Directive 2014/30/EU Low Voltage Directive 2014/35/EU UL/IEC/EN 60950 EN 60601-1-1, EN60601-1-2 

Wi-Fi antenna 

Built-in omni-directional antennas: 5 GHz (4.6 dBi), 2.4 GHz (4.0 dBi) 

Radio coverage 

Outdoor-hardened, Wi-Fi 6 dual radio, 5 GHz 4x4 MIMO and 2.4 GHz 2x2 MIMO Software-configurable dual radio supports 5 GHz (Radio 0) and 2.4 GHz (Radio 1) Maximum data rates of 4.8 Gbps in the 5GHz band and 575 Mbps in the 2.4GHz band 

Product Dimensions (imperial) 

10.6 x 9.0 x 9.4 in (H x W x D) 

 

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the primary performance specifications of the Aruba AP-575 outdoor access point? +
The Aruba AP-575 (R4H17A) utilizes 802.11ax Wi-Fi 6 technology to deliver high-capacity wireless connectivity. It features a dual-radio design with a 2x2:2 configuration on the 2.4GHz band and a 4x4:4 configuration on the 5GHz band. This architecture ensures high throughput and efficient client handling in challenging outdoor environments, making it ideal for dense deployments like stadium seating, parking lots, or outdoor industrial campuses.
How does the integrated antenna design benefit outdoor deployments? +
This model comes with integrated omnidirectional antennas, which simplify the installation process by eliminating the need for external cabling and precise antenna alignment. The internal antenna array is specifically tuned for wide-area coverage, providing robust signal distribution and consistent performance. This is particularly advantageous for mounting on poles or walls where a low-profile, weather-resistant aesthetic is required without sacrificing wireless reach.
Is the R4H17A suitable for extreme environmental conditions? +
Yes, the Aruba AP-575 is purpose-built for outdoor environments. It features a ruggedized, weather-rated chassis designed to withstand harsh elements, including rain, extreme temperatures, and high humidity. Its design ensures that internal components remain protected, providing the high level of reliability required for persistent outdoor connectivity in public spaces or remote industrial facility sites.
What is the significance of the 802.11ax standard for this outdoor AP? +
The implementation of 802.11ax, or Wi-Fi 6, allows this access point to utilize advanced features like OFDMA and MU-MIMO. These technologies enable the AP to handle multiple simultaneous data streams more efficiently, significantly reducing latency and increasing total network capacity in areas with high user density. It ensures that outdoor Wi-Fi remains fast and responsive even when serving a large number of mobile devices simultaneously.

Is this specific model (RW) restricted to certain regions? +
The (RW) suffix indicates that this access point is designed for the Rest of World regulatory domain. It is configured to operate within the standard frequency ranges and power limits defined by international wireless regulations outside of the United States. Always verify that your specific regional frequency requirements align with the capabilities of this model before finalizing your deployment plans.
